        흰쥐에서 발정주기에 따른 자발적인 췌장외분비의 변화

        박형서,이태임,김세훈,박형진,양일석,Park, Hyung-seo,Lee, Tae-im,Kim, Se-hoon,Park, Hyoung-jin,yang, Il-suk 대한수의학회 2000 大韓獸醫學會誌 Vol.40 No.4

        Since the role of female sexual hormones on pancreatic exocrine secretion was not fully understood, this study was investigated to clarify the difference of spontaneous pancreatic exocrine responses during the estrous cycle and the roles of ovarian hormones on pancreatic exocrine secretion in the anesthetized female rats. Pancreatic juice was collected from the sequential 15-min samples, and then fluid and protein secretion were measured from the collected samples. The stages of estrous cycle were defined by staining the vaginal smear. The spontaneous pancreatic fluid and protein secretion were significantly increased during the diestrus stage compare to the corresponding value during the estrus stage. In the ovariectomized rat, spontaneous pancreatic exocrine secretion was significantly decreased compare to the value of female rat during the diestrus stage and was restored by subcutaneous injection of progesterone (50 mg/kg). This results suggest that the spontaneous pancreatic exocrine secretion of female rat is fluctuated according to the estrous cycle and progesterone released from ovary could stimulate the spontaneous pancreatic exocrine secretion of female rat.

        랫드의 췌장외분비 기능에 대한 암수 비교연구

        박형서(Hyung-Seo Park),김세훈(Se-Hoon Kim) 한국실험동물학회 2004 Laboratory Animal Research Vol.20 No.2

        본 연구는 랫드의 췌장소엽을 이용하여 암수차이에 따른 췌장내 amylase함량의 차이, 기초상태에서의 자발적인 amylase 분비기능의 차이 및 CCK로 촉진한 amylase 분비기능의 차이를 비교하고자 실시하였다. 암컷의 발정주기는 질도말법을 이용하여 판정하였으며 췌장외분비의 촉진을 위하여 CCK를 농도별로 배양액에 첨가하였다. 실험결과 수컷랫드의 췌장내 amylase함량은 휴지기 및 발정기의 암컷 랫드의 췌장내 amylase함량과 차이가 없었다. 그러나 수컷 랫드로부터 분리한 췌장소엽에서 기초상태에서의 자발적인 amylase 분비율은 휴지기의 암컷 랫드와는 차이가 없었으나, 발정기의 암컷 랫드에 비해서는 높음을 관찰하였다. CCK를 배양액에 첨가한 경우 췌장외분비 기능은 농도 의존적으로 증가하였으나, 100pM의 CCK로 촉진한 췌장외분비 기능에 있어서는 암수에 따른 차이가 관찰되지 않았다. 이러한 실험 결과로 미루어보아 췌장의 소화효소인 amylase 합성에 있어서는 암수에 따른 차이가 없는 반면 기초상태에서의 자발적인 amylase 분비기능에 있어서는 발정기의 암컷 랫드가 수컷 및 휴지기의 암컷 랫드에 비해 유의하게 낮음을 알 수 있었다. 그렇지만 이러한 차이는 췌장외분비 기능에 대한 강력한 촉진제인 CCK에 의해 사라지는 것으로 여겨진다. 따라서 췌장외분비 기능을 실험함에 있어 암컷 랫드를 사용할 경우 발정주기에 따른 차이가 존재하므로 신중을 기해야 할 것으로 사료된다. Cellular amylase contents, spontaneous amylase secretion, and cholecystokinin (CCK)-induced amylase secretion were compared from the male and female rats using the isolated pancreatic lobules. Estrous stages of female rats were characterized by vaginal smears. To stimulate amylase secretion, CCK (100 pM) was added to incubation medium. Cellular amylase contents of male pancreatic lobule were similar to that found in female pancreatic lobules at diestrus and estrus. Spontaneous pancreatic amylase secretion of male rats was higher compared to female rats at estrus, but not different from female rats at diestrus. cholecystokinin markedly stimulated pancreatic amylase secretion, dose¬dependently. However, CCK-induced pancreatic amylase secretion of male rat was not different from female rat at estrus and diestrus. We conclude from the above results that pancreatic amylase synthesis was not different according to sex, and that spontaneous pancreatic amylase secretion was lower in female rat at estrus. However, These differences were thought to be masked by more potent stimulants in pancreatic amylase secretion.

        Q 방법론을 활용한 갈등행위자 인식유형 및 특성에 관한 연구: 가로림조력발전소 건설계획을 중심으로

        이순자 ( Soon Ja Lee ),박형서 ( Hyung Seo Park ) 한국지방행정연구원 2011 地方行政硏究 Vol.25 No.2

        그동안 공공갈등의 예방과 원활한 해결을 위한 다양한 노력이 있었다. 그러나 각종 정책 입안이나 계획수립 및 사업추진을 둘러싼 이해관계 충돌은 여전히 심각하게 전개되는 양 상이다. 특히 국토 및 지역개발에 따른 갈등은 정책 비효율성과 사회적 비용증대의 주요 요인으로 작용하고 있다. 이러한 배경에서 본 연구는 지금까지 정부의 갈등관리가 제도적 기반 마련에 치중한 반면, 개개인이 지니는 가치, 믿음이나 신념, 관점, 의견, 선호 등 환 경·조건에 쉽게 변하지 않으면서 갈등상황에 지속적으로 영향을 미치는 행위자 인식을 간 과해 왔다는 문제의식에서 출발한다. 따라서 갈등을 일으킨 해당이슈나 사업에 대해 지니 는 관련자들의 내면인식을 유형화하고 유형별 특성을 찾아내어 각 인식유형에 따른 대응 방안을 모색하는데 연구목적이 있다. 연구의 차별화와 사람의 내면인식에 대한 접근을 위해 Q 방법론을 활용하였고, 이를 통 해 조사된 자료의 분석은 PC용 QUANL 프로그램을 이용하였다. 연구목적과 방법론의 특수성을 감안하여 갈등상황이 현재 지속되고 있으면서 정치적 원인이 갈등상황 전개에 핵심변수로 작용하지 않는 것을 사례 중에서 최근 기후변화와 맞물려 정책적 차원에서 주목 받고 있는 ``가로림조력발전소 건설갈등``을 연구대상으로 최종 선정하였다. 분석결과, 가로림조력발전소 건설에 대한 관련자들의 인식은 정부불신·냉소형, 생계염 려·실리추구형, 기대·낙관주의형, 환경·생태계가치중시형, 대의명분의존형, 사업추진확신 형의 6개 유형으로 구분되었다. 대의명분의존형이나 사업추진확신형을 제외하면 각 유형 마다 어느 정도 뚜렷한 특성을 보이는 것으로 나타났다. 이처럼 개개인의 마음, 즉 내면심리나 주관적인 가치와 실제 원하는 바를 정확하게 파악할 수 있다면, 찬·반이라는 이분법 적 대응차원을 넘어 다양한 인식유형별로 적절한 처방을 마련하는데 유용할 것이다. This study aims to introduce a new approach to make up for the weak points in the current conflict management system, to explore views of people involved in conflict situation on the basis of this new approach, to draw some kind of types and their unique features from diverse views, and to propose how to apply the analytic results to the real process of public conflict management. The main method employed is the Q methodology, which is useful for analyzing the inner viewpoint of people and their real intention - labeled as ``subjectivity`` in academic term. In order to find out the subjectivity of people, one case is examined: the head-on confrontation among groups in Seosan-si and Taean-gun over the construction of Garolim tidal power plant. Though there are limitations to one case study, the Q analysis shows that there are several types of subjectivity in public minds and each type has distinctive features and differences. It means that it is able to develop more effective and practical measures to deal with conflicts in pushing the development project. By using QUANL PC Program, the case of Garolim tidal power plant classified people`s views into six factors, named as the type: distrusting the government; pursuing practical interest; having optimistic expectation; putting emphasis on environmental and ecological value; seeking for a great cause; and believing firmly the implementation of project. There are few studies that focus on individual minds of stakeholders in finding out conflict causes and solutions in spatial development projects. It means that it is too early to generalize the results of one case study to other conflict cases. Even though it may have some limits to find out possible policy application, however, this attempt could provide useful suggestions to public authorities seeking for desirable models analyzing people`s views to prevent and reduce public conflicts.

        체결 성능 향상을 위한 FPCB 커넥터의 형상설계

        김대영(Dae-Young Kim),박형서(Hyung-Seo Park),김웅겸(Woong-Kyeom Kim),표창률(Chang-Ryul Pyo),김헌영(Heon Young Kim) 대한기계학회 2012 大韓機械學會論文集A Vol.36 No.3

        최근 휴대폰은 스마트폰의 출연으로 다기능화가 요구되고 있으며, 각 보드의 전기적 신호를 연결시키는 커넥터는 필수 핵심 부품이 되었다. 커넥터는 많은 양의 전기신호를 처리하기 때문에 소형화, 협피치화가 필요하다. 하지만, 커넥터의 소형화 및 협피치화는 구조적 안전성을 저하시키며, 외부하중에 의한 접촉불량을 발생시킨다. 따라서 본 논문에서는 초소형 협피치 FPC 커넥터를 개발하기 위해 벤치마킹을 통한 초기설계안을 도출하였으며, 터미널 두께 0.2mm, 개수 50 개를 기준으로 하였다. 체결성능을 평가하기 위해 수치해석 모델을 구성하였으며, 다구찌 방법을 이용하여 형상 최적화를 수행하였다. 또한, 터미널의 한계수명을 예측하기 위해 피로해석을 수행하였으며, 체결 성능이 향상된 최종형상을 도출하였다. Recently, multi-functionalization (as in smart phones) has been in demand, and the connectors connecting the electrical signals of each board in a cellular phone have become key components. The miniaturization of these connectors is required to achieve a finer pitch design and enhance the electrical signal transfer capacity. However, the miniaturization of connectors reduces the structural safety, and a finer pitch design may cause contact problems under external impact. In this paper, a preliminary design for miniaturized, finer-pitch connectors is suggested for a product with 50 pins and a thickness of 0.2 mm. The assembly process of the FPCB (Flexible Printed Circuit Board) and connector was simulated to ensure the holding force between the two components and avoid overstressing. The design optimization process was performed with the Taguchi method. Fatigue analysis was also conducted to predict the fatigue life of the terminal, and the theoretical and experimental results were compared.

        ST분절 상승 심근경색 환자의 일차적 관동맥중재술까지 시간 지연 인자

        김정애 ( Jeong Ai Kim ),정진옥 ( Jin Ok Jeong ),안계택 ( Kye Taek Ahn ),박형서 ( Hyung Seo Park ),장원일 ( Won Il Jang ),김민수 ( Min Soo Kim ),짐준형 ( Jun Hyung Kim ),박재형 ( Jae Hyeong Park ),이재환 ( Jae Hwan Lee ),최시완 ( S 대한내과학회 2010 대한내과학회지 Vol.78 No.5

        Background/Aims: The time delay for a patient from the onset of disease symptoms until the reperfusion therapy is one of the biggest interruptions in early reperfusion therapy in patients with acute ST-segment elevation myocardial infarction (STEMI). Here, we evaluated both the duration and nature of these time delays to facilitate early patient reperfusion therapy. Methods: Patients with acute STEMI who were undergoing primary percutaneous coronary intervention (PCI) were prospectively enrolled in the Chungnam National University Hospital from January 2005 to December 2007. Results: From a total 364 patients (mean age: 64±12 years) the mean time interval from the onset of symptoms to the decision to visit a hospital was 101.4±10.6 (median: 50.0) minutes. The mean time interval for the onset of disease symptoms to the patient arrival at the emergency room (ER) (pre-hospital delay) was 222.1±12.4 (median: 171.5) minutes. The mean time interval from the ER to reperfusion (door to balloon time) was 89.0±6.0 (median 65.0) minutes. The mean time interval from the onset of symptoms to successful reperfusion therapy (pain to balloon time) was 311±13.6 (median: 250) minutes. The factors associated with these significant time delays were mainly: residency in rural areas, the use of private transport in preference to an ambulance and finally the transferal of patients from other hospitals. As a result of multivariate analysis the latter was found to be the most significant causative factor. Conclusions: This study demonstrates that there is a significant pre-hospital time delay in patients with STEMI. Thus, a media campaign explaining STEMI symptoms, the importance of early visits to the emergency department, the use of an ambulance, and the activation of the base hospital for efficient patient transfer (particularly in rural areas) may reduce this time delay in patients with STEMI and avoid interruptions to otherwise efficient reperfusion therapies. (Korean J Med 78:586-594, 2010)

      • 안면화상 인식의 자동화 가능성에 관한 연구

        朴逈緖,金熙昇 서울市立大學校 1994 論文集 Vol.28 No.-

        With the development of fast computers, it became possible to process digital picture images which needs complicated computation and large memory. The purpose of this paper is to consider the techniques for computer recognition of human faces. Various schemes on facial recognition are introduced. Specially, the identification of human faces based on isodensity maps was a selected topic since this seems to be a new approach deviated from the conventional feature point approach. However it was restricted by many circumstantial conditions. Therefore, we suggest a new technique based on the second derivatives of gray level which represents the curvature of face surfaces. This is a promising technique for face recognition because of its firm analogy between images and real shapes of human faces.
